1. Healthcare Electronic ICs:

Health-related Digital Built-in Circuits (ICs) are specialised semiconductor devices created to meet up with the stringent prerequisites of professional medical purposes. These ICs are engineered to provide superior functionality, accuracy, and dependability, generating them perfect for use in important clinical products including individual monitors, defibrillators, infusion pumps, and professional medical imaging devices.

While in the health care field, precision and regularity are paramount, and Professional medical Electronic ICs are tailor-made to deliver specific analog and digital signal processing, sensor interfacing, energy management, and interaction abilities. They go through arduous tests and certification procedures to be sure compliance with market standards and polices, for instance ISO 13485 and IEC 60601, governing the safety and performance of clinical gadgets.

two. Microcontrollers:

Microcontrollers are compact built-in circuits that integrate a central processing unit (CPU), memory, enter/output ports, and also other peripherals into just one chip. In clinical electronics, microcontrollers serve as the "brains" of varied products, delivering the computational electrical power and control needed for product operation and features.

Healthcare equipment typically involve actual-time facts processing, sensor integration, user interface Management, and interaction capabilities, all of which can be successfully managed by microcontrollers. Regardless of whether It is really checking important signals, administering therapy, or controlling machine parameters, microcontrollers enable exact Management and automation, maximizing the efficiency and usefulness of professional medical equipment.

3. Monolithic ICs:

Monolithic Integrated Circuits (ICs) are semiconductor devices fabricated on an individual silicon wafer, wherever all parts, together with transistors, resistors, capacitors, and interconnections, are integrated into just one chip. While in the health care subject, monolithic ICs obtain applications in an array of health care units, like implantable health-related units, diagnostic gear, and wearable wellness monitors.

The compact dimension, low electric power intake, and significant dependability of monolithic ICs make them nicely-fitted to professional medical purposes the place Room, electrical power efficiency, and longevity are essential issues. No matter if It truly is developing miniaturized implantable devices or moveable diagnostic instruments, monolithic ICs allow the event of State-of-the-art healthcare solutions that increase patient results and Standard of living.
